Having read through the Westbury on Severn site and seen their work. This looked like a project I could take on. I needed to learn some front end development skills for work, so the opportunity to build a site to control the scoreboard appealed. I had already messed around with a Raspberry Pi and this project also gave me the opportunity to learn how to use the Arduino, along with a chance to build the electronics and gain some new skills in woodwork.
The way I see it I can break this project down into 4 parts (assuming you want to make work for yourself like me and don’t reuse the Arduino code and web site code).
- Arduino controller code
- Scoreboard controlling website
- Building the electronic circuits
- Building the scoreboard
